What Is IELTS?

IELTS is a standardized test created to assess the English language efficiency of non‑native speakers. The exam determines 4 core language skills: listening, reading, writing, and speaking. Results are reported on a nine‑point band scale, from "non‑user" (band 1) to "expert user" (band 9). Many universities and migration authorities need a minimum band score of 6.0 7.0, depending on the institution or visa classification.


IELTS Test Format

The test is provided in 2 variations: IELTS Academic and IELTS General Training. Both variations share the exact same listening and speaking areas, however the reading and writing jobs vary to reflect the purposes of each track.

How to Prepare for IELTS

1. Understand the Test Structure

Familiarize yourself with each area's timing, question types, and marking criteria. Authorities IELTS practice products offer sample tests that mirror the real exam.

2. Construct a Study Schedule

  • Weeks 1‑2: Review essentials-- grammar, vocabulary, and listening skills.
  • Weeks 3‑6: Focus on each skill; complete practice tests under timed conditions.
  • Weeks 7‑8: Take full‑length practice tests, evaluation responses, and determine weak points.

3. Use Quality Resources

4. Practice Speaking Regularly

  • Partner with a fellow candidate or tutor for mock interviews.
  • Record your responses and self‑evaluate using the public band descriptors.
  • Goal to promote 1‑2 minutes on a Cue Card subject without pausing.

5. Develop Time Management

  • In the reading section, spend approximately 20 minutes per passage, then proceed.
  • In composing, allocate 20 minutes to Task 1 and 40 minutes to Task 2, leaving 5 minutes for checking.

6. Reinforce Listening Skills

  • Listen to various English accents (British, Australian, American) through podcasts, news broadcasts, and films.
  • Practice "forecasting" responses before the recording plays; this improves focus.

Tips for Success on Test Day

  • Get here Early: Allow time for recognition checks and to settle any nerves.
  • Bring Valid ID: A passport or national identity card is needed; the name needs to match your application.
  • Follow Instructions Carefully: Misreading a concern can cause lost marks.
  • Stay Calm During the Listening Section: If you miss out on a response, carry on; do not dwell, as you can not replay the audio.
  • Compose Legibly: Handwritten reactions are scanned; unclear handwriting might impact scoring.
  • Speak Clearly and at a Natural Pace: The examiner examines fluency, not speed.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. For how long is the IELTS certificate valid?

IELTS outcomes are legitimate for 2 years. After that, numerous organizations might request a new test, as language efficiency can change gradually.

2. Can I take IELTS more than when?

Yes. There is no limit on the number of attempts, though you need to wait a minimum of a couple of days before re‑registering for a paper‑based test (computer‑delivered tests often enable a shorter turn-around).

3. What is the distinction between "Computer‑Delivered IELTS" and "Paper‑Based IELTS"?

Both variations have similar material and scoring. Computer‑delivered deals much faster outcomes (generally 3‑5 days) and more flexible scheduling, while paper‑based stays familiar to those who choose composing by hand.

4. Do I require to take both Academic and General Training?

No. Select the version that matches your objective. Most university candidates take Academic; those requesting migration or work typically take General Training.

5. How is the speaking test arranged?
